Willa Lentz in Szczecin invites you to the concert "Fryderyk Chopin at Villa Lentz. Complete Works", which will be performed by Jim-Isaac Chua. Start: Saturday, 7 p.m.
Jim-Isaac Chua is a Filipino-American pianist who, as Lani Spahr has written, is known for his extraordinary talent and virtuosity of the highest order, delighting audiences around the world. Since his solo debut at New York’s Carnegie Hall (Weill Recital Hall) and the Kościuszko Foundation in 2009, he has performed in the United States, Canada, Poland, France, Italy, Austria, Myanmar, Indonesia, and the Philippines, winning international acclaim and numerous awards at prestigious piano competitions. Music critics have called his playing “exceptional pianistic mastery and artistry in the most demanding repertoire, which seems to reach the limits of human ability.”
In the 2023/2024 season, the artist performed in over 40 concert halls around the world, including the United States, Poland, France, Austria, and the Philippines. Key venues include: Three-Rivers Convention Center, Coastal Concerts Venue, Pacific Maritime Heritage Center, Seattle Polish Cultural Center, Kimbrough Concert Hall, Bing Crosby Theater, Gesellschaft für Musiktheater, Wiener-Krakauer Kultur Gesellschaft, and Fernan Cebu Press Center.
Currently living in Poland, the pianist regularly gives concerts throughout the country.
